My Clever sync status is on hold

For Remind Hub district administrators who completed a Clever sync.

The district administrator in charge of your sync will be notified via email whenever a sync is placed on hold.

Data removals

Remind holds syncs that will significantly impact your data. This is an opportunity to review the data removals to ensure they're expected. You'll see this hold type whenever Clever syncs are updated during the semester and year-end changes, such as removing people and classes and changing source IDs.  

  • If you don't expect the changes, contact your SIS administrator or Clever Support to help undo the removals in Clever. Once you've addressed the issue, click Check for new Clever data, and confirm the action on the next screen by clicking Yes, continue.mceclip0.png
  • If you expect the data removals, click Confirm removals. mceclip1.png

Data configuration

This hold is caused for two reasons:

  • Students have six or more guardians associated with them.
  • Some people in your data have the "emergency" or "secondary" contact type in Clever.

We don’t recommend creating accounts for emergency or secondary contacts. We also don't recommend creating an account for people who should not receive messages about students.

  1. If you need to filter out emergency and secondary contacts from your data shared with Remind, you can contact your SIS administrator or Clever Support.
  2. Once you've removed emergency and secondary contacts from your data shared with Remind, click Check for new Clever data, and then click Yes, Continue on the school's SIS sync report. Remind will process the sync immediately.

Disconnected

Your Clever sync will be placed on hold if Remind cannot connect with Clever.

  1. Check your settings in Clever. Make sure of the following:
    • You have the Remind app installed in Clever. You can install the Remind app here.
    • You are sharing the correct data with Remind. We recommend sharing data by school. You can learn more about sharing settings with Remind here.
  2. Once you've addressed the above, click I fixed it on the school's SIS sync report. Remind will attempt to reconnect with Clever and process the sync immediately.
